Kafka共0篇
Kafka
消息队列 CKafka 跨洋数据同步性能优化-五八三

消息队列 CKafka 跨洋数据同步性能优化

导语 本文主要介绍了 CKafka 在跨洋场景中遇到的一个地域间数据同步延时大的问题,跨地域延时问题比较典型,所以详细记录下来做个总结。 一. 背景 为了满足客户跨地域容灾、冷备的诉求,消息队...
admin的头像-五八三admin2年前
0120
手记系列之六 ----- 分享个人使用kafka经验-五八三

手记系列之六 —– 分享个人使用kafka经验

前言 本篇文章主要介绍的关于本人从刚工作到现在使用kafka的经验,内容非常多,包含了kafka的常用命令,在生产环境中遇到的一些场景处理,kafka的一些web工具推荐等等。由于kafka这块的记录以及...
admin的头像-五八三admin2年前
050
SpringBoot3集成Kafka-五八三

SpringBoot3集成Kafka

目录一、简介二、环境搭建1、Kafka部署2、Kafka测试3、可视化工具三、工程搭建1、工程结构2、依赖管理3、配置文件四、基础用法1、消息生产2、消息消费五、参考源码 标签:Kafka3.Kafka-eagle3;...
admin的头像-五八三admin2年前
0490
从Kafka中学习高性能系统如何设计 | 京东云技术团队-五八三

从Kafka中学习高性能系统如何设计 | 京东云技术团队

1 前言 相信各位小伙伴之前或多或少接触过消息队列,比较知名的包含Rocket MQ和Kafka,在京东内部使用的是自研的消息中间件JMQ,从JMQ2升级到JMQ4的也是带来了性能上的明显提升,并且JMQ4的底层...
admin的头像-五八三admin2年前
090

大碗宽面-Kafka一本道万事通

前言 时隔小一个月,博主又更新啦。本文以chatGPT总结为基础,各种博客或者大佬个人网站的分享为补充,最后推出自己的口语化总结,力求打造一本完善的,体系化的Kafka理论知识宝典。本文分为五...
admin的头像-五八三admin2年前
0140
Kafka关键原理-五八三

Kafka关键原理

日志分段切分条件 日志分段文件切分包含以下4个条件,满足其一即可: 当前日志分段文件的大小超过了broker端参数 log.segment.bytes 配置的值。log.segment.bytes参数的默认值为 1073741824,即...
admin的头像-五八三admin2年前
0120
Kafka-基础-五八三

Kafka-基础

1. 简介 Kafka(Apache Kafka) 是一种分布式流数据平台,最初由LinkedIn开发,并于后来捐赠给Apache软件基金会,成为了一个Apache顶级项目。它被设计用于处理大规模、实时的数据流,并为构建高...
admin的头像-五八三admin2年前
050
基于 DTS 同步 MySQL 全增量数据至 CKafka,构建实时数仓的最佳实践-五八三

基于 DTS 同步 MySQL 全增量数据至 CKafka,构建实时数仓的最佳实践

背景介绍 随着 IT 技术与大数据的不断发展,越来越多的企业开始意识到数据的价值,通过大数据分析,可以帮助企业更深入地了解用户需求、更好地洞察市场趋势。目前大数据分析在每个业务运营中都...
admin的头像-五八三admin2年前
0110
【实战分享】使用 Go 重构流式日志网关-五八三

【实战分享】使用 Go 重构流式日志网关

项目背景 分享之前,先来简单介绍下该项目在流式日志处理链路中所处的位置。 流式日志网关的主要功能是提供 HTTP 接口,接收 CDN 边缘节点上报的各类日志(访问日志/报错日志/计费日志等),将...
admin的头像-五八三admin2年前
070
面试官提问: Kafka 是如何做到消息不丢或不重复的?-五八三

面试官提问: Kafka 是如何做到消息不丢或不重复的?

你好,我是肖恩。相信大家在工作中都用过消息队列,特别是 Kafka 使用得更是普遍,业务工程师在使用 Kafka 的时候除了担忧 Kafka 服务端宕机外,其实最怕如下这样两件事。 消息丢失。 下游系统...
admin的头像-五八三admin2年前
090
分布式流处理组件-理论篇:Broker-五八三

分布式流处理组件-理论篇:Broker

? 作者:谢先生。 2014年入行的程序猿。多年开发和架构经验。专注于Java、云原生、大数据等技术。从CRUD入行,负责过亿级流量架构的设计和落地,解决了千万级数据治理问题。 ? 微信公众号、B站...
admin的头像-五八三admin2年前
0120
从Kafka中学习高性能系统如何设计-五八三

从Kafka中学习高性能系统如何设计

1 前言 相信各位小伙伴之前或多或少接触过消息队列,比较知名的包含Rocket MQ和Kafka,在京东内部使用的是自研的消息中间件JMQ,从JMQ2升级到JMQ4的也是带来了性能上的明显提升,并且JMQ4的底层...
admin的头像-五八三admin2年前
090
kafka高性能设计原理-五八三

kafka高性能设计原理

Kafka系统架构 Kafka是一个分布式流处理平台,具有高性能和可伸缩性的特点。它使用了一些关键的设计原则和技术,以实现其高性能。 上图是Kafka的架构图,Producer生产消息,以Partition的维度,...
admin的头像-五八三admin2年前
050
面试官提问:Kafka 高吞吐架设计在生产端是如何体现的?-五八三

面试官提问:Kafka 高吞吐架设计在生产端是如何体现的?

Kafka 一个特点就是吞吐量大,而且是大数据场景的首选消息队列。根据真实生产环境数据,Kafka 单机能达到同时生产和消费百万级量级的数据量。 这到底是怎样的一个概念呢?我们结合生产环境中对...
admin的头像-五八三admin2年前
080
Kafka两种集群详解和搭建教程-五八三

Kafka两种集群详解和搭建教程

Kafka是一个能够支持高并发以及流式消息处理的消息中间件,并且Kafka天生就是支持集群的,今天就主要来介绍一下如何搭建Kafka集群。 Kafka目前支持使用Zookeeper模式搭建集群以及KRaft模式(即...
admin的头像-五八三admin2年前
0100
Kafka再平衡-五八三

Kafka再平衡

Kafka 再平衡 1  何为 Kafka 再平衡 再平衡就是一个协议,它规定了如何让消费组下的所有消费者来分配 Topic 中的每一个分区。例如:一个 Topic 有 100 个分区,一个消费者组内有有 20 个消费者...
admin的头像-五八三admin2年前
040

Spark消费Kafka数据多线程异常的解决方案

我正在参加「掘金·启航计划」 概述 KafkaConsumer is not safe for multi-threaded access的报错通常是因为KafkaConsumer被多个线程共享导致的。在Kafka 2.4版本的源码中我看到该特性仍然不被...
admin的头像-五八三admin2年前
070
kafka如何保证消息不丢-五八三

kafka如何保证消息不丢

概述 Kafka架构如下,主要由 Producer、Broker、Consumer 三部分组成。一条消息从生产到消费完成这个过程,可以划分三个阶段,生产阶段、存储阶段、消费阶段。 生产阶段: 在这个阶段,从消息在 ...
admin的头像-五八三admin2年前
0180
kafka Topic not present in metadata after 200 ms 引发的思考(上)-五八三

kafka Topic not present in metadata after 200 ms 引发的思考(上)

前言 有天有位同学跟我说,一直没收到我的“消息”,然后看了眼日志: 发现线上居然有几十个kafka异常,其中就有我的topic send时的异常: throwable :[org.apache.kafka.common.errors.TimeoutE...
admin的头像-五八三admin2年前
020
macOS 系统 Kafka 快速入门-五八三

macOS 系统 Kafka 快速入门

Kafka 的核心功能是高性能的消息发送与高性能的消息消费。以下是 Kafka 的快速入门教程。 下载并解压缩 Kafka 二进制代码压缩文件 打开 Kafka 官网的下载地址,可以看到不同版本的 Kafka 二进制...
admin的头像-五八三admin2年前
050